About Daniel Teixidor

Daniel Teixidor is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Computational Mechanics,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Biomedical Engineering and Ophthalmology, having authored 11 papers that have together received 313 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ced machining processes and optimization (8 papers), Laser Material Processing Techniques (7 papers), Advanced Surface Polishing Techniques (6 papers), Advanced Machining and Optimization Techniques (5 papers), Laser Design and Applications (2 papers), Ocular and Laser Science Research (1 paper), Additive Manufacturing Materials and Processes (1 paper) and Manufacturing Process and Optimization (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Computational Mechanics (165 citations), Mechanical Engineering (209 citations),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(54 citations), Biomedical Engineering (130 citations) and Acoustics and Ultrasonics (2 citations). Daniel Teixidor has collaborated with scholars based in Spain, United States and Mexico. Frequent co-authors include Joaquim Ciurana, Tuğrul Özel, I. Ferrer, Guillem Quintana, Ciro A. Rodrı́guez, Andrés Bustillo, Maciej Grzenda, Thanongsak Thepsonthi, Francisco Orozco and Jesús Maudes. Their work appears in journals such as The International Journal of Advanced Manufacturing Technology, Materials and Manufacturing Processes, International Journal of Machine Tools and Manufacture, Robotics and Computer-Integrated Manufacturing and Journal of Manufacturing Processes.
